I was thinking about a subject that has come up before about FIRST listening to us, our ideas on things, etc… and after knowing some of the topics covered at the team forum… an idea sprouted…
what if we listened to each other?
ok…think about it… we have these forums which are a great and well-appreciated tool for communication, discussing pros and cons etc… but what about the basic team on-goings each year like fundraising, student travel, meetings, etc… some teams out their have some really good set-ups that we could learn and change from and rookies could build off of…
so what if… on the FIRST website there was a page set-up under which people could post things that work for their team and things that don’t (we made team cookbooks, made a lot of money- other stuff, we barely broke even on…) catagorized under certain topics. Even if it was just a post your team’s method- no response posts or threads to deal with- and attach an email address at which your team could be contacted.
This could hook-up rookies with veterens…(hey, maybe we could have a big brother kinda program for teams…more ideas…) and help us all improve and share our ideas
what’s everyone thinking?? and brandon, would that be an overwhelming amount of work for someone at FIRST to upkeep…or you think it’s relatively easily possible…?
